Bequia Basketball Tournament blazing hot

The Bequia Basketball Tournament continued last weekend with some sizzling action. Dominated by Second Division fixtures, Gladiatorz and Young Blazers both recorded two victories each.{{more}}

Gladiatorz beat Rising Stars II 72 to 49, with Vibert Davis leading the way with 18 points for the victors, while Gladiatorz’ second win came when they defeated Young Duke 74-63. Davis again with 18 points, so too was Cosmus Hackshaw were the high flyers for their team. The leading scorer for Young Duke was Damien Lewis with 27 points.

Like Gladiatorz, Young Blazers chalked up consecutive wins. First they blew away Liberty 92-35, then downed Warriaz 71 to 57. Against Liberty, Jemuel Hutchins was the top scorer with 20 points and versus Warriaz Fritz Lewis took the spotlight with 15 points for Blazers, but he was still out-pointed as Lindell Sandy sank 29 points for the losers.

There was one First Division fixture and one Under-16 fixture also played on the weekend.

In First Division action, Duke won over East Blazers 71 to 60.

Leading the way for Duke was Bradford Duncan with 28 points, while for East Blazers, Michael Peniston and Cornelius Farrell knocked in 18 points each.

In Under 16 Division action Diamondz defeated Young Wizards 26 to 16.

The leading scorer for Diamondz was Daria Gordon with 14 points.(RT)
